Operating Engineer - Full Time

Disneyland Resort is looking for an Operating Engineer to support their theme parks by performing operational checks and maintenance on essential systems. The role involves troubleshooting and repairing equipment such as boilers and chillers to ensure guest comfort and operational efficiency.

Responsibilities

Perform operational and functional checks of central plants for our facilities and world-famous attractions
Providing direct support to Resort-wide hot water, chilled water, and compressed air requirements
Perform troubleshooting and repair of systems and equipment (boilers, chillers, compressors)
Installations, maintenance, and quality checks of completed work

Required

You must be at least 18 years of age to be considered for this role
Journeyman Operating Engineer or maintenance machinist experience
Unlimited CFC license
Background as a Utilities Man Class A or C, Boiler Technician Class A or C
Ability to use special tools and equipment
Familiarity with pumps, compressors, boilers, chiller units, cooling towers, and associated equipment
Familiarity with alignment of pumps and shafts
Ability to read and interpret blueprints and schematic
Familiarity with, or have the ability to learn, the Computerized Maintenance Management System ('Maximo')

Preferred

AA/AS in Engineering, Maintenance Management, or equivalent

Walt Disney opened Disneyland Park on July 17, 1955, with hopes that it would become “a source of joy and inspiration to all the world.” Since then, the Disneyland Resort in Anaheim, Calif., has welcomed guests from around the world, expanding to become an approximately 500-acre, multifaceted, world-class family resort destination, complete with two renowned Disney theme parks, three hotels and the Downtown Disney District known for its exciting shopping, dining and entertainment.
